PIMIENTO SAUSAGE BALLS



Pimiento sausage balls image

I make these on New Year's Day to snack on while taking down the Christmas tree (or while watching ball games if you're my husband).

Categories     Lunch/Snacks

Time 35m

Yield 102 pieces

Number Of Ingredients 8

16 ounces mild pork sausage or 16 ounces hot pork sausage
3 cups biscuit mix (like Bisquick)
3 cups grated cheddar cheese
1 (4 ounce) jar diced pimentos, drained
1/2 tablespoon garlic powder
1/2 tablespoon hot sauce, such as tabasco
sweet and sour sauce (optional)
barbecue sauce (optional)

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350°.
  • In a large bowl of an electric mixer, combine sausage, biscuit mix, cheese, pimientos, garlic powder and hot sauce; mix on medium speed until well combined, about 1 minute.
  • Add water by the tablespoonful, if necessary, to get mixture to a workable consistency.
  • Shape into 1-inch balls and place 1/2-inch apart on baking sheets.
  • Bake for 20-25 minutes or until bottoms are golden brown.
  • Serve warm with sauces, if desired.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 42.4, Fat 2.8, SaturatedFat 1.2, Cholesterol 6.8, Sodium 96, Carbohydrate 2.4, Fiber 0.1, Sugar 0.5, Protein 1.8
